“The Best Winter Season Jamaica Has Ever Had” 

By: Caribbean Journal Staff - April 22, 2023

Jamaica is having its best winter season of all time, according to the island’s Tourism Minister, Edmund Bartlett. 

Jamaica is estimating 1.18 million visitors in the first quarter, a 94.4 percent increase over the same period last year. 

That represents tourism earnings of $1.15 billion, according to Bartlett. 

This follows a sizzling 2022 that saw 3.3 million visitor arrivals to the island.

“this is the biggest and best winter season Jamaica has ever had in the history of tourism,” Bartlett said. 

“If there was ever an industry that has the potential to transform our nation, our communities and the lives and livelihoods of the Jamaican people for the better, it is tourism,” Bartlett said. 

Indeed, Jamaican GDP is projected to grow by 3 to 5 percent in January compared to the first quarter of 2022.

“Never before in the history of Jamaica has tourism made such a great contribution to the national economy and we are willing to contribute to that process and to make even greater contributions,” he said. “Jamaicans at all levels of society can enjoy a bigger slice of the tourism pie.”

The projection, Bartlett said, is for tourism to continue to be the biggest driver of economic growth on the island.
